I agree! 15's = lighter weight, better gear ratios. Can't beat 'em. I used a 10 year old beat to hell yoko A008R's this past auto-x season on my Integra, man they grip like mad, fun as hell! Be careful, chunks of rubber started coming off towards the end of the season, and finally the cords came through. I wouldn't reccommend using them on the street (no matter how fun it may be) just because what Ted said....and my experience, in the middle of the run I'd loose a huge "chunk" of the tread....but autox is safe b/c your going under 60 for the most part.
